Output 6c4e4c9c60bd24a719180f30349becfa6619b621ee63d9ddb68ddac48e52836d:21

value
25366661
script pubkey
OP_0 OP_PUSHBYTES_20 dd9bc18e8d9fd4f523bcd1ecf9d20cd1122ece3b
address
bc1qmkdurr5dnl202gau68k0n5sv6yfzan3mznxxst
transaction
6c4e4c9c60bd24a719180f30349becfa6619b621ee63d9ddb68ddac48e52836d